Lagos—A 24-year-old cleaner, Faith Ofeimu, was, yesterday, arraigned before a Tinubu Magistrate’s Court, Lagos, for allegedly stealing phones and cash, valued at N532,800 from a business-man who offered her a lift.
The defendant is facing a two-count charge of stealing preferred against her by the police.
The prosecutor, Koti Aondohemba, told the court that the defendant committed the offence on April 24, at 11:30p.m.
He said that the incident took place at the residence of the complaint, Benson Bright, at 4, Tokunbo Street, Lagos Island.
However the defendant pleaded not guilty to the charges.
Magistrate Salama Matepo, granted her N100,000 bail, with two sureties in like sum and adjourned till June 24.
